Art Exhibitions: A Feast for the Eyes
The summer season brings a plethora of art exhibitions to the city. The Metropolitan Museum of Art is hosting ‘Making Marvels,’ an exhibition that showcases the art of the court of Burgundy in the late medieval period. Meanwhile, the Museum of Modern Art (MoMA) is presenting ‘Being: New Photography 2022,’ an exhibition that explores the theme of identity through the lens of contemporary photographers. These exhibitions offer a glimpse into different eras and cultures, providing a rich tapestry of human experience.

Music Festivals: A Symphony of Sounds
Music lovers are in for a treat this summer, with a series of music festivals that cater to various genres. The Governors Ball Music Festival, held in Randall’s Island, features a lineup of popular artists and bands across different genres. Meanwhile, the Lincoln Center Out of Doors festival offers a diverse range of music, from classical to contemporary, reflecting the city’s rich musical heritage.
Community Engagement and Education
The city’s cultural institutions are also focusing on community engagement and education. The Brooklyn Museum’s ‘First Saturdays’ program offers free admission and a variety of activities for families and individuals. The program includes workshops, performances, and tours, providing an opportunity for visitors to engage with art in a meaningful way. Similarly, the Bronx Museum of the Arts is hosting a series of workshops and lectures that explore the intersection of art and social justice.
Culinary Delights: A Gastronomic Journey
New York City’s culinary scene is as diverse as its cultural landscape. This summer, food enthusiasts can embark on a gastronomic journey, exploring the city’s vibrant food markets and restaurants. The Smorgasburg food market, held in Williamsburg and Prospect Park, offers a variety of local and international cuisines. From artisanal cheeses to gourmet tacos, the market is a food lover’s paradise.
